About The Commons at Dallas Ranch

The Commons at Dallas Ranch is a neighborhood located in Antioch, CA. With a crime score of A, this area has very low or no crime compared to other neighborhoods in the city.

The neighborhood has a population of approximately 74 residents with a median household income of $108,242.
